Job description

We are seeking an experienced and dynamic Managing Director to lead and manage the overall operations and strategic direction of the company. The MD will be responsible for overseeing the implementation of business objectives, driving financial performance, and ensuring effective operational management across departments. This leadership role requires a high-level executive who can balance both the strategic and operational demands of the organization.

As a key decision-maker, the MD will work closely with the senior leadership team and report directly to the Board of Directors, guiding the company toward achieving its vision and goals while fostering a high-performance culture.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Strategic Leadership: Define and implement the company’s strategic goals and objectives in alignment with the vision set by the Board of Directors. Lead the creation of long-term business strategies that drive growth, innovation, and market expansion.
  • Operational Management: Oversee day-to-day operations across all business functions, including sales, marketing, finance, human resources, and customer service, ensuring efficiency and alignment with company goals.
  • Financial Management: Manage and monitor the company’s financial performance, ensuring profitability, cost management, and effective resource allocation. Develop budgets, financial forecasts, and key performance indicators (KPIs) to ensure the business stays on track.
  • Leadership & Team Development: Lead and mentor senior management and department heads, ensuring effective performance management, professional development, and talent retention across the organization.
  • Business Development: Identify new business opportunities, partnerships, and market segments to expand the company’s market share and revenue streams. Foster relationships with key stakeholders, clients, and industry leaders.
  • Risk Management & Compliance: Monitor and mitigate risks related to financial, operational, and legal matters. Ensure the company adheres to industry regulations and complies with corporate governance standards.
  • Stakeholder Communication: Serve as the primary liaison between the Board of Directors, senior management, and other stakeholders. Prepare and present regular updates on company performance, strategic initiatives, and key challenges.
  • Cultural Stewardship: Shape and maintain the organizational culture, ensuring that the company’s values, mission, and vision are clearly communicated and embraced across all levels of the organization.
  • Market & Industry Insight: Stay informed of market trends, competitor activities, and industry developments to guide the company’s strategic direction and innovation efforts.
